Key job responsibilities:

The candidate shall act as a finance business partner for the country and across a variety of new programs and processes.

  • Lead planning and performance reviews for the country and various programs you are responsible for.
  • Create and build models to manage and deliver the plan for growth and profitability. Hold teams accountable for their designed KPIs .
  • Deliver meaningful insight and practical recommendations, in addition to sound financial data analysis, to inform and influence business decisions.
  • Deliver accurate financial information and key financial reporting to senior management including spends, ROIs, performance by channels and category.
  • Represent Finance in MBRs, QBRs with narrative on performance.
  • Evaluation of Initiatives: Analyze various ‘initiatives’ agreed with Category, Country, and program teams. Identify and document learnings, and share with the teams for better planning.
  • Work on attribution models to allocate spends by Channel and Product line.
  • Build processes, tools, dashboard to support the business and improve decision making
  • Understand the inherent limitations of data and exercise judgment to make trade-offs between timeliness and accuracy of analysis and how to best synthesize findings.
  • Work with product managers to influence new program requirements and business decisions.
